溫馨提示×

centos jenkins如何監控系統資源

小樊
55
2025-06-08 11:02:44
欄目: 智能運維

在CentOS上監控Jenkins系統資源可以通過多種插件和工具來實現,以下是一些常用的監控方法:

使用Jenkins自帶的Monitoring插件

  • 簡介:Jenkins自帶的Monitoring插件可以通過JavaMelody生成包含CPU、系統負載、平均響應時間和內存使用等信息的HTML報告。
  • 安裝步驟
    1. 在Jenkins的“系統管理” - “插件管理”中搜索并安裝“Monitoring”插件。
    2. 安裝完成后,在“系統管理” - “Monitoring of Jenkins master”中查看監控儀表盤。

使用Prometheus和Grafana進行監控

  • 簡介:Prometheus是一個開源的監控和告警系統,可以通過拉取Jenkins暴露的指標數據來進行監控。Grafana是一個開源的數據可視化工具,可以與Prometheus結合使用,展示Jenkins的監控數據。
  • 整合步驟
    1. 在Jenkins上安裝Prometheus插件,配置暴露指標數據的接口。
    2. 配置Prometheus抓取Jenkins的指標數據。
    3. 在Grafana中增加Prometheus數據源,并添加Jenkins的性能和健康概覽面板。

使用Zabbix進行監控

  • 簡介:Zabbix是一個企業級的開源監控解決方案,可以通過安裝Jenkins Metrics插件來監控Jenkins。
  • 具體配置
    1. 在Jenkins上安裝Metrics插件,并生成Access Key。
    2. 在Zabbix服務器上配置監控模板,鏈接至主機組。
    3. 在Zabbix agent上配置獲取Jenkins指標數據的腳本,并配置觸發器實現告警。

使用內置插件

  • 簡介:Jenkins內置了一些監控插件,如節點磁盤空間監控等,可以幫助快速了解系統的運行狀態。
  • 使用方式:在插件管理中搜索并安裝需要的監控插件,如節點磁盤空間監控等。

使用Dynatrace Application Monitoring

  • 簡介:Dynatrace Application Monitoring是一個應用性能管理工具,可以提供可視化和上下文細節,幫助管理和操作數據。
  • 使用方式:根據Dynatrace的官方文檔進行配置和集成。

通過上述方法,您可以根據具體需求選擇合適的監控方案來監控您的CentOS上的Jenkins實例。無論是使用內置插件、Prometheus和Grafana的開源解決方案,還是Zabbix和Dynatrace Application Monitoring的商業解決方案,都能夠幫助您有效地監控和管理Jenkins的運行情況。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女